The document discusses different number systems including binary, octal, hexadecimal and ASCII. It provides information on memory capacity conversions defining bytes, kilobytes, megabytes etc. in terms of powers of 2 or 1024. Octal and hexadecimal number systems are positional systems with bases of 8 and 16 respectively, where each digit represents powers of the base. ASCII code includes uppercase and lowercase letters, digits, punctuation and special characters used to represent text in computing.
